SACC-New York speaker on 'The Giant Move'

Luncheon with Lars-Eric Aaro, president and CEO, LKAB, and the seminar 'Kiruna — The Giant Move'

Image

On Tuesday, March 3, SACC-New York hosted a seminar and luncheon about Kiruna, Sweden’s northernmost town, which is undergoing one of the most exciting urban transformations of all time.

Held at Restaurant Aquavit, the program featured representatives from the municipality of Kiruna, representatives from White Arkitekter and Lars-Eric Aaro, CEO of the mining company, LKAB. Each of the speakers has a key role in the “Giant Move,” an ambitious 20-year project that involves relocating the city two miles to the east of its present location.
